Narakchur
Narakchur, commonly known as Bitter Ginger, is a traditional herb celebrated for its numerous health benefits. Its scientific name is Zingiber zerumbet, and it is also referred to as Shampoo Ginger due to the gelatinous liquid found within its stalks, which was historically used as a natural shampoo. This herb has been utilized in various cultures for centuries, particularly in Ayurvedic and traditional medicine, for its therapeutic properties.
1. Digestive Health
Bitter Ginger has been traditionally used to improve digestion and reduce bloating. It aids in alleviating abdominal discomfort and promotes regular bowel movements, contributing to overall gastrointestinal well-being. Incorporating Narakchur into herbal teas or consuming it in powdered form can support digestive health.
2. Anti-Inflammatory Properties
The herb possesses natural anti-inflammatory agents that help in reducing inflammation in the body. This makes it beneficial for conditions such as arthritis, where inflammation of the joints leads to pain and stiffness. Regular consumption of Narakchur may assist in managing such inflammatory conditions.

8. Skin Health
Traditionally, the gelatinous liquid from Narakchur has been used as a natural shampoo, benefiting scalp health and promoting hair growth. While specific studies on its direct effects are limited, its use in traditional practices suggests potential advantages for skin and hair care.
